Meaning
从来不 is an emphatic adverb meaning 'never' or 'have never,' expressing that something has not happened at any time from the past up to now. It strongly emphasizes the complete absence of an action or state throughout one's entire experience or a long period of time.
Usage
从来不 is placed before the main verb and is commonly used in both spoken and written Chinese. It carries a stronger, more absolute tone than simply using 不. Often used when emphasizing personal habits, experiences, or character traits that have remained consistent over time. Can be shortened to 从不 in casual speech.
Examples
- 01他从来不迟到。.He is never late.
- 02我从来不吃辣的东西。.I never eat spicy food.

Common collocations
- 从来不会would never, is never able to
- 从来不曾have never once
- 从来不敢never dare to

Origin
Literally means 'from come not,' expressing the idea of 'from the time of coming (to now), not.' The phrase combines 从来 (since the past, all along) with the negation 不 to create an emphatic never.
